Handover note — Admin bulk edits (for weekly eng sync)

State of play on the Ledgewick admin table: bulk edits now batch in groups of 200 with optimistic locking; conflicts surface in a review drawer instead of failing silently. Remaining work is the undo window (designs approved, backend half done) and audit-log entries for multi-row changes. Test fixtures live in the harness repo. From Monday, all bulk-edit questions and PRs route to the engineer below.

account owner for kafop-haweg: Pelax Gilael Istir

**Ticket: Cron drift on Larkspur schedulers**

New folks: the nightly rollup job on Larkspur has been firing 3–7 minutes late since the Quillbay datacenter move. We suspect NTP sync gaps on the worker pool, not the scheduler itself. Please do not adjust the crontab offsets as a workaround; that masks the drift and breaks downstream reconciliation in Pondwright. Capture clock deltas from at least three workers before filing findings. The affected build is identified below.

session token of tajef-bageg = htk21_5d90d574934f3ccae6437

Ticket for weekly sync: the Saltmere tide-table widget shows tomorrow's low tide when the user's locale crosses midnight UTC. Root cause is a date truncation in the Harborlight feed parser. Fix is one line; regression test added. Needs a verified staging deploy before Friday. The staging run emitted the token below.

trace token, bahap-kagup: htk3_528

## Deep-Link Routing — Hopline App

Deep links in Hopline resolve through the route registry: scheme, host, then path pattern. If a link dead-ends on the home screen, the pattern didn't match — check the registry first, not the client. Universal links require the published manifest; custom-scheme links bypass it. Common ticket causes: expired campaign routes and missing locale segments. Route definitions live in the routing database, versioned per release. To look up a route when triaging, connect with the string below.

replica DSN, kajep-yahag: mssql://praok_svc:iF@db-8d68.plorvaio.local:5432/eliion

# This constant points at the locale directory scanned by the Lingvoharvest
# extraction script. If you add a new module under src/, run the extractor
# before committing so translators at the Verlanda office see fresh strings.
# Extraction runs nightly too, but don't rely on it for release branches.
# When filing an extraction bug, include the trace token printed below.

pipeline stamp: htk4_ae36